About this program

The Global Early Modern Studies program at CUNY Graduate School and University Center focuses on the cultural, social, political, and economic transformations that shaped the early modern world. Through an interdisciplinary approach, this course delves into various subjects including literature, history, philosophy, and the arts, allowing students to explore the nuanced relationships between different cultures across the globe from the 15th to the 18th century.

Students will engage with primary texts in various languages, gain critical thinking skills, and develop the ability to analyze historical contexts through diverse perspectives. The curriculum is designed to equip students with research methodologies necessary to understand the complexities of the early modern era, thus fostering a strong foundation in both theoretical and practical approaches to global history.

In addition to the core curriculum, students have the opportunity to tailor their education with electives that cater to their specific interests, encouraging a personalized learning experience. The course also emphasizes the importance of studying in a vibrant urban setting, where historical and contemporary cultures intermingle, thus enhancing the academic experience and providing unique resources for research.

Entry requirements

To be considered for the Global Early Modern Studies program, applicants typically need a bachelor's degree in a related field, such as humanities, history, or social sciences. A strong academic record and demonstrable interest in early modern studies are essential, along with any relevant research or work experience that showcases the applicant's engagement with the subject matter.

English:

International students must demonstrate proficiency in English, typically through standardized tests. The program usually requires a minimum IELTS score of 7.0 or a TOEFL score of 100, ensuring that students possess the necessary language skills to succeed in an academic environment.

International students:

International students must obtain a student visa to study in the country. They should prepare necessary documentation, including proof of enrolment, financial support, and health insurance. It is crucial for students to check official visa requirements and procedures to ensure compliance before applying.
